Transaction eb44031849f7ada9b883257c599a9861c3697bdde17d6d2e9d75b18fe53b8530
1 Input
1 Output
-
eb44031849f7ada9b883257c599a9861c3697bdde17d6d2e9d75b18fe53b8530:0
- value
- 18717869
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 67e7af466e387f060392935dcf6e1edd0b5d0215 OP_EQUAL
- address
- 3BAR52zsiZg77DFe6JZCmuHcg4FtXtQLNX